Subject: Key rotation — Partira profile-shard service

Team,

As part of the user-profile store sharding cutover, the old monolith credential is revoked effective tonight. All shard routers in the Casselbrook cluster must switch to the new credential before the 02:00 migration window or writes will fail closed. Staging has already been flipped and verified. No action needed for read replicas; they inherit from the router. Update your release checklist to reference the rotated credential. The new key for the profile-shard service follows.

service key, bajep-hahig: zpat15_8GdlyV2kd9BCqYH

- [ ] **Step 7: Breaker override escrow.** After sealing the signing keys for the Tallgrove upstream API circuit breaker, confirm the support team can force the breaker open during a full outage. The override bundle lives in the sealed escrow drawer and is useless without its unlock phrase. Two ceremony witnesses must initial this step before proceeding. The escrow bundle is decrypted with the recovery passphrase that follows.

vault phrase of kahip-kahop = holath-quenmir

MEMO — Kettling Depot Receiving

Uniform sets for the new Kettling depot arrive Wednesday via Ashgrove courier: 40 boxes, sorted by size, manifest attached to box one. Check the count at the dock before signing; shortages go straight to stores, not the courier. The hand-over instruction the courier will follow is set out below.

drop instructions, tafof-baguf: the holmir gilox courier leaves the sormir ulaok holdor ledger at gate 5596 under passcode 257343

[ ] Verify alert dedup window before cutover

New folks: the Hollowpine deduplicator collapses alerts sharing a fingerprint within a 5-minute window. Before promoting a release, fire the synthetic alert pair from staging and confirm exactly one page reaches the test rotation. If two arrive, the fingerprint hash changed — stop the release. Record the verified build by its token below.

build token for tawip-yageg: htk9_92ac43d42